We are a friendly group of nature enthusiasts and for anyone with an interest in evolution and biology. We meet mainly for talks in the autumn season, and field trips during the spring when flowering plants can best be enjoyed. Our main topics are the fauna and flora of Cyprus, but we are open to any natural history subject, and welcome guest speakers.
For our talks, we meet for refreshments from 10.30, and have the talk from 11.00 - 12.00. Field trips usually 10.45. Afterwards we generally go somewhere nearby for a convivial lunch.
Dave and Ros have been studying and photographing the wildlife of Cyprus for almost 20 years, and produced a couple of books: "The Amphibians and Reptiles of Cyprus" and "Wildlife of Cyprus", the latter with 44 authors and over 1100 photos from 100 photographers.
The group also benefits from members with extensive knowledge of wild flowers.
